							"HOME | FRONT"  
Lt. Cmdr. Dave Shellington is a pediatric intensive care doctor at the NATO hospital in Kandahar, Afghanistan. Separation is nothing new for Dave and his wife, Tammy, but this is their first time apart as parents. Sydney, his daughter, is often on his mind. His wife Tammy feels the weight of single motherhood. Their lives are worlds apart, yet intersect in unexpected ways.
